Palm net access via a Hotsync craddle

Mochasoft, has released a new product called Mocha W32 PPP. Mocha W32 PPP can be used to connect your PalmPilot to a Windows-95/98 box directly through a serial cable or the Hot-Sync adapter, giving direct access to the network (Internet) on your local PC.
With Mocha W32 PPP you will not need a modem to use TCP/IP applications on your PalmPilot, which come in very handy since you don't need to be on the phone all day.
